1860

Small Cents · Indian Head Cents · 1859–1909
Regular
Weight4.67 g
Diameter19 mm
MintPhiladelphia
StrikeCirculation strike
Mintage 20,566,000 Combined mintage for all 1860 varieties
EdgePlain
Alignment↑↓ Coin
Composition88% Copper, 12% Nickel
DesignerJames B. Longacre

About this coinHistory

The 1860 Indian Head cent introduced the Oak Wreath with Shield reverse that would remain the standard for the rest of the series. The simpler Laurel Wreath of 1859 was replaced by a more elaborate wreath of oak leaves with a small federal shield at the top. The reverse change gave the coin a more official, governmental appearance. The obverse portrait remained the same, though minor refinements to the portrait continued across die pairs.

The 1860 was struck in large quantity (over 20 million coins) and circulated widely. The United States was on the brink of the Civil War, which would begin in April 1861. The economic dislocations of the coming conflict would affect coinage profoundly: within two years, hoarding would drive coins of all denominations out of circulation, and the Mint would respond with emergency measures including composition changes and fractional currency notes.

Surviving 1860 cents are available across a wide grade range. The coin is a natural choice for representing the Oak Wreath reverse in a type set. Good to Fine examples are affordable, and Uncirculated coins, while scarcer, appear at auction regularly enough that a selective buyer can find one with good strike and attractive surfaces.

Price guideReference

Reference data only — not an appraisal.

GradeDescriptionLowHigh
G-4 Good (G) $10 $11.50
VG-8 Very Good (VG) $14.50 $16.50
F-12 Fine (F) $19.50 $23
VF-20 Very Fine (VF) $36 $42
EF-40 Extremely Fine (EF) $65 $75
AU-50 About Uncirculated (AU) $94 $108
MS-60 Uncirculated (MS) $162 $187
MS-63 Choice Uncirculated (MS) $345 $365
